Other Features
Superior sound quality.
Make your music more natural.
360 Spatial Sound Personalizer.
MULTIPOINT CONNECTION : Quickly switch between two devices at once.
STAY CONNECTED : Ambient Sound Mode keeps you aware of your surroundings.
POCKED SIZED CASE : Small and cylindrical, the charging case is made to fit your pocket or your bag.
WATER RESISTANT : With an IPX4 resistance rating, splashes and sweat won’t stop these headphones – so you can keep moving to the music.
EASY HANDS- FREE CALLING : A built-in microphone provides you with hands-free calling. No need to even take your phone from your pocket.
ALL DAY COMFORT : Light and compact to give you all-day comfort and designed for the ideal fit, for an exceptional all-round listening experience.
LONG BATTERY LIFE & QUICK CHARGING : Up to 11 hours of battery life ( up to 22hrs with case ) with quick charging ( 5 min charge for up to 1 hour of playback ).
EASY BUTTON OPERATION : Play, stop, skip tracks, adjust the volume, access your smartphone’s voice assistant and receive calls hands-free with the touch of a button.

Key Differences

Philips SHB2515BK/00 and Sony WF-C510 are well-known options in the wireless headphone segment, offering a balance of audio quality, battery performance, and smart features. Both headphones are equipped with capable drivers that deliver balanced sound output suitable for music, calls, and entertainment. Battery life varies between the two (70 Hours vs 8 - 11 Hours), which affects how long you can use them on a single charge. There is a noticeable difference in weight (116 gm vs 31 GM), which may affect comfort during extended use. Impedance levels vary (16 ohm vs 16 Ohms), which can affect compatibility and audio output when used with different devices. The frequency response differs (20 Hz - 20000 kHz vs 20Hz - 20KHz), which can influence how well the headphones reproduce lows, mids, and highs. Philips SHB2515BK/00 uses Bluetooth 5.0 while Sony WF-C510 supports Bluetooth 5.3, which can impact connectivity stability and efficiency. Philips SHB2515BK/00 and Sony WF-C510 offer different noise cancellation capabilities (Passive vs Sound Isolation), which can impact how effectively they block external noise.
